I started taking 3 weeks off for Christmas, so I get a week to recover and to plan if needed. Game changer!! I just add the week to the end of the school year. I still have 8 weeks off in summer, doing a 4 day school week. We do about 5 to 6 hours a day, including outside time (30 minutes) and lunch (30 minutes). Also, don’t forget about a good phonics program. Sonlight is great for the rest, but weak in phonics, especially for the younger ones. ❤❤

I will definitely be taking your editor's red pen approach to our scope and sequences as well. I have found a lot of my stress ease when I moved my planner to Notion and Trello. That way if I am on week 6 of science and week 8 of history I don't feel "behind" and Trello automates my To-Do lists that always are the same (loops). I also try to have "break in case of emergency" plan: were I have a list of extra documentaries, audiobooks, etc. that come out if I am sick or overwhelmed.
